J. Bryan Grimes papers, 1760-1935 (bulk 1880-1935).

Abstract The agricultural papers of J. Bryan Grimes and brother, Alston, who owned farms in Pitt and Beaufort Counties, comprise the bulk of the collection. Also included are papers of Major General Bryan Grimes and personal papers of the Grimes and Laughinghouse families. Topics of correspondence include late 19th century social life and customs; student life at the University of North Carolina; European travel; race relations in North Carolina; attempts to burn Washington, N.C.; production of tobacco, cotton, potatoes, and other crops; and the settlement of Scots in eastern North Carolina. Other items include a diary; business, financial, and legal papers that detail Grimes family farm operations; papers related to the North Carolina Tobacco Growers Association, North Carolina Secretary of State, North Carolina Appomattox Commission, and the North Carolina Board of Agriculture; genealogical materials; material related to the Grimesland School; essays and speeches written by J. Bryan Grimes while he was a student at the University of North Carolina; and land records, which include deeds for land in Georgia and Pitt, Beaufort, and Chatham Counties.

Biographical noteJohn Bryan Grimes grew up on the plantation, Grimesland, in Pitt County, N.C. An active farmer, he served as president of the North Carolina Tobacco Growers Association and in 1899 was appointed to the North Carolina Board of Agriculture. He held the position of North Carolina Secretary of State from 1901 until his death in 1923.
